Coimbra's impregnated core bits are designed for precision. Unlike surface set bits, which have diamonds bonded to the surface, impregnated bits have diamonds uniformly distributed throughout the matrix, allowing for continuous cutting as the bit wears down. This makes them ideal for drilling in fine-grained or abrasive rock, where maintaining sample integrity is critical. The company offers a range of sizes, from BQ (36.5mm) to PQ (85mm), catering to projects of all scales—from small-scale environmental studies to large mineral exploration campaigns.

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Carbide Core Bit Supplier

Selecting the right carbide core bit supplier is critical to the success of your drilling project. With so many options available in Portugal, it can be challenging to know where to start. Below are key factors to keep in mind to ensure you choose a supplier that meets your needs in terms of quality, reliability, and value.

1. Product Quality and Certification

The quality of carbide core bits directly impacts drilling efficiency, sample integrity, and tool lifespan. Look for suppliers that use high-grade materials, such as premium tungsten carbide and synthetic diamonds, and have certifications like ISO 9001 (quality management) or API (for oil and gas applications). Certifications indicate that the supplier adheres to strict industry standards, reducing the risk of receiving subpar products.

2. Product Range and Specialization

Consider your specific drilling needs. Are you working in hard rock, soft soil, or abrasive formations? Do you require impregnated core bits for precision sampling or surface set bits for speed? Suppliers with a diverse product range, like Porto Drilling Solutions or Setúbal Drilling Components, can cater to multiple applications. If you have specialized needs, such as deep oil well drilling, look for suppliers with expertise in that area, like Aveiro Mining Technologies.

3. Manufacturing or Trading Focus

Manufacturers like Lisbon Core Tools and Braga Carbide Works offer the advantage of customization and direct quality control. Traders like Leiria Core Bit Traders and Guimarães Carbide Distributors may provide lower prices and a wider range of products by sourcing from multiple manufacturers. Decide whether you need custom solutions (manufacturer) or cost-effective, readily available tools (trader).

4. Customer Support and Technical Expertise

A supplier with strong technical support can help you select the right tools, troubleshoot issues, and optimize drilling performance. Look for companies with experienced engineers or geologists on staff, like Coimbra Exploration Tools or Faro Drilling Supplies, who can provide guidance on bit selection, maintenance, and drilling techniques.

5. Delivery Times and Logistics

Projects often have tight deadlines, so reliable delivery is crucial. Wholesalers with large inventories, like Faro Drilling Supplies, can offer quick turnaround for standard products. Manufacturers may have longer lead times but can prioritize urgent orders for regular clients. Consider the supplier's location and shipping network—proximity to your project site can reduce delivery costs and delays.

6. Pricing and Value for Money

While cost is important, the cheapest option may not always be the best value. A slightly more expensive bit that lasts longer and drills faster can save money in the long run. Compare prices across suppliers, but also consider factors like tool lifespan, performance, and after-sales support to determine true value for money.
